Proteas arrive in New Zealand─── 09:16 Fri, 06 Feb 2015
The South African national cricket team have arrived in New Zealand ahead of the ICC Cricket World Cup which gets underway next week.
The Proteas jetted off to the Land of the Long White Cloud on Wednesday evening as they go hunting for their first ever World Cup.

Star batsman Hashim Amla did not travel with the team after going down-under with his family a few days prior.
Coach Russell Domingo is of the view that his squad is well-balanced and will have each other backs when the chips are down.
“They’ve won games under high pressure situations, under different conditions at different venues”, Domingo added.
South Africa face Sri Lanka on Monday at Hagley Oval in Chirstchurch in a warm-up match, before their opener against Zimbabwe in Hamilton next Sunday.
Co-hosts Zealand and Sri Lanka will lock-horns in the tournaments opening match on 14 February.
